Kärpät: star player’s contract terminated!
Oulu Kärpät announces that it has terminated the contract of Canadian forward Ben Tardif.
According to the Oulu club, the initiative to terminate the contract came from the player.
– We have been discussing the situation with Ben for a while, and as a club, we feel this is the best solution for both parties. We are losing a good player, but at the same time, we have the opportunity to build a more balanced team – now and in the future, says Kärpät’s sports director Kimmo Kapanen in the statement.
Tardif played a total of 80 Liiga games for Kärpät over two seasons. Before that, he played for one season with KooKoo.
– I want to thank the organization, fans, and players for the support I have received while being in Oulu. I wish all the best for Kärpät, the Canadian forward says in the statement.
According to Expressen, Tardif’s next destination would be the SHL club Luleå. It has been reported that Kärpät will receive a compensation of 100,000 euros for the transfer.
